Diagnosis

Diagnosing heart disease begins with a physical examination and a discussion of your medical history. A healthcare professional will ask about your symptoms, lifestyle, and family history of heart conditions. Listening to your heart and checking your pulse and blood pressure are also part of the initial evaluation.

To confirm a diagnosis and identify the cause or extent of heart disease, several tests may be recommended.

Common diagnostic tests include:

  • Blood tests: These check for markers of heart damage such as cardiac enzymes that leak into the bloodstream after a heart attack. A high-sensitivity C-reactive protein (CRP) test measures inflammation in the arteries. Other tests may check cholesterol, triglycerides, and blood sugar levels to assess overall heart health.

  • Chest X-ray: Shows the size and shape of the heart and detects fluid buildup in the lungs, which can indicate heart failure.

  • Electrocardiogram (ECG or EKG): A simple and quick test that records the heart’s electrical activity to identify irregular rhythms or previous heart attacks.

  • Holter monitoring: A portable ECG worn for 24 hours or more that tracks heart activity during daily routines to detect irregular heartbeats.

  • Echocardiogram: Uses ultrasound waves to produce detailed moving images of the heart, showing how well it pumps blood and whether the valves are functioning properly.

  • Exercise or stress tests: Measure how the heart responds to physical exertion on a treadmill or stationary bike. If you can’t exercise, medications may be used to simulate exercise effects on the heart.

  • Cardiac catheterization: Involves inserting a thin tube through a blood vessel to the heart. A special dye is injected to reveal blockages or narrowing in the coronary arteries on X-ray images.

  • Heart CT scan: Uses X-rays to capture detailed cross-sectional images of the heart and chest, showing calcium deposits or blockages in the arteries.

  • Heart MRI scan: Produces high-resolution images of the heart using magnetic fields and radio waves to assess structure, tissue damage, and blood flow.

Treatment

Treatment for heart disease varies depending on its type, severity, and underlying cause. The goal of treatment is to manage symptoms, improve heart function, and prevent complications such as heart attack or stroke.

Typical treatment strategies include lifestyle changes, medications, and in some cases, surgical procedures.

Lifestyle changes

Adopting a heart-healthy lifestyle is essential for managing heart disease. This may include:

  • Eating a diet low in sodium, saturated fats, and cholesterol

  • Exercising regularly under medical guidance

  • Maintaining a healthy weight

  • Quitting smoking and limiting alcohol intake

  • Managing stress through relaxation or counseling

Medications

Different medications may be prescribed depending on your diagnosis and symptoms. These can include:

  • Blood pressure medications to reduce strain on the heart

  • Cholesterol-lowering drugs such as statins

  • Blood thinners to prevent clots

  • Beta blockers or ACE inhibitors to support heart function and control heart rate

  • Diuretics to reduce fluid buildup in cases of heart failure

Surgery or Other Procedures

In more serious cases, heart disease may require interventional procedures or surgery to restore proper blood flow or repair heart damage. Options may include:

  • Angioplasty and stenting: To open blocked arteries and restore normal circulation

  • Coronary artery bypass grafting (CABG): To reroute blood around blocked arteries

  • Valve repair or replacement: For damaged or diseased heart valves

  • Implantable devices: Such as pacemakers or defibrillators to manage irregular heart rhythms

Effective heart disease management combines medical care, healthy habits, and regular follow-up with a healthcare provider. Early diagnosis and consistent treatment can greatly improve long-term heart health and quality of life.
